WebSep 7, 2024 · A copyright notice is made up of three required elements, and one optional element: The copyright symbol, or word "copyright". A date. Name of the copyright owner. Statement of rights (optional) The format of a copyright notice is usually: copyright symbol - date - name of copyright owner - statement of rights. WebOct 21, 2024 · A copyright notice is a statement used to warn your users or readers that the work that they are consuming is your intellectual property and that you hold rights to it. In other words, its purpose is to publicly state and claim ownership of the original work that you have created and its related rights. A copyright notice is usually fairly ...
